Description : Define rectification efficiency. Give its formula.
Last Answer : The ratio of output DC power delivered to the load to the applied input AC power is called rectification efficiency. It is denoted by η. η = Output DC power delivered to the load / Input AC power from transformer secondary η = Pdc / Pac
